WebSource: R/count-tally.R count () lets you quickly count the unique values of one or more variables: df %>% count (a, b) is roughly equivalent to df %>% group_by (a, b) %>% summarise (n = n ()) . count () is paired with tally (), a lower-level helper that is equivalent to df %>% summarise (n = n ()).
